Why is Comfort a Critical Factor in Selecting Men’s Backpacking Boots?
Comfort is a critical factor in selecting men’s backpacking boots because it directly affects performance, injury prevention, and overall hiking experience. Wearing comfortable boots enhances mobility and reduces fatigue, allowing hikers to focus on the trail rather than their feet.
According to the American Orthopaedic Foot & Ankle Society, comfort in footwear is defined as having adequate cushioning, proper fit, and minimal pressure points that contribute to the overall health and well-being of the feet during physical activity.
Several underlying reasons explain why comfort is vital for backpacking boots. First, prolonged hiking can lead to foot fatigue. A boot that fits well distributes weight evenly and supports the arch, reducing strain on muscles and ligaments. Second, the terrain varies in roughness, which means good cushioning absorbs shocks and protects feet. Lastly, discomfort can lead to blisters or injuries, which may derail a hiking trip.
Key technical terms include “arch support” and “cushioning.” Arch support refers to the boot’s design to maintain the natural arch of the foot. Cushioning is the material that absorbs shock during impacts. These features are essential for maintaining comfort during long hours of hiking.
Comfortable boots enable proper biomechanics while walking. When a boot offers good support and cushioning, it promotes a natural walking motion, reducing unnecessary strains on the knees and joints. Poorly fitting boots can cause a range of issues, including blisters, calluses, and even serious injuries like tendonitis.
Specific conditions that contribute to discomfort include lack of proper sizing, inadequate arch support, and inappropriate materials. For example, a boot that is too narrow can pinch the foot, while one lacking sufficient arch support can lead to pain in the arch area. A weight-bearing hike over rough terrain intensifies these discomforts. Therefore, ensuring that boots fit correctly and provide necessary support and cushioning is crucial for a successful hiking experience.
What Waterproofing Options Are Available for Men’s Backpacking Boots?
The waterproofing options available for men’s backpacking boots include various technologies and materials to ensure feet stay dry during outdoor activities.
- Gore-Tex
- eVent
- Waterproof Leather
- Rubber Overlays
- Seam Sealing
- Waterproof Membranes
- DWR (Durable Water Repellent) Coating
The context surrounding these options highlights their effectiveness and shortcomings in different conditions.
-
Gore-Tex:
Gore-Tex is a popular waterproofing technology used in men’s backpacking boots. Gore-Tex features a breathable membrane that allows moisture from sweat to escape while preventing water from entering. This technology is highly regarded for its durability and long-lasting performance. According to a study by the University of Minnesota, footwear with Gore-Tex retains waterproof properties for an extended period, even after multiple washes. -
eVent:
eVent is another waterproof membrane similar to Gore-Tex, but it offers faster breathability. The technology allows sweat vapor to escape more efficiently, making it ideal for high-energy activities. Studies have shown that eVent’s breathability rate is higher, providing better comfort during strenuous backpacking. Outdoor Gear Lab tested multiple boots and found that those with eVent technology kept the wearer’s feet dry in varying weather conditions. -
Waterproof Leather:
Waterproof leather is treated to resist moisture while maintaining breathability. This natural material provides a classic aesthetic along with durability. However, the waterproofing is dependent on proper maintenance, such as regular conditioning. A case study involving leather boots showed that, with proper care, waterproof leather can outperform synthetic options in longevity. -
Rubber Overlays:
Rubber overlays are additional layers or reinforcements applied to specific areas of the boot, enhancing water and abrasion resistance. These overlays provide extra protection in high-wear areas without compromising flexibility. Research from the Journal of Footwear Science highlighted that boots with rubber overlays have significantly better durability in muddy and wet terrains. -
Seam Sealing:
Seam sealing involves applying a waterproof sealant along stitching lines. This process prevents water from sneaking into the boot through needle holes. Boot models with comprehensive seam sealing are more effective in extremely wet conditions. A study by the American Hiking Society noted that seam-sealed boots perform notably better in heavy rain compared to those without this feature. -
Waterproof Membranes:
Various manufacturers produce their proprietary waterproof membranes that function similarly to Gore-Tex or eVent. These membranes vary in breathability and durability. Users often provide mixed reviews on these options, depending on personal experience. Customer feedback on websites like REI reveals that while some users find them effective, others experience reductions in breathability over time. -
DWR (Durable Water Repellent) Coating:
DWR is a treatment applied to the outer surface of the boot to help water bead and slide off. The coating enhances the boot’s initial resistance to moisture. However, it requires reapplication after extensive use, as it can wear off. Outdoor research indicates that DWR-treated boots can be effective for light rain but may not withstand prolonged exposure to water.
Each waterproofing option offers different benefits and limitations based on usage, environmental conditions, and personal preference.

What Maintenance Tips Can Extend the Lifespan of Men’s Backpacking Boots?
To extend the lifespan of men’s backpacking boots, proper maintenance is crucial. Following specific care routines can improve durability and performance significantly.
- Clean boots regularly
- Dry boots properly
- Apply waterproofing treatments
- Store boots correctly
- Replace insoles and laces as needed
- Inspect for damage frequently
- Avoid excessive exposure to heat
Regular maintenance is key for ensuring backpacking boots remain functional and reliable over time.
-
Clean Boots Regularly: Maintaining cleanliness is essential for backpacking boots. Dirt and mud can damage materials and decrease breathability. Cleaning boots after each hike, using mild soap and water, helps keep them in good condition.
-
Dry Boots Properly: Proper drying prevents mold and degradation of boot materials. After use, remove insoles and let boots air dry in a cool, ventilated space. Avoid direct heat sources, as they can warp and crack materials.
-
Apply Waterproofing Treatments: Waterproof treatments protect the boots from moisture. Regular applications of waterproof sprays or wax ensure that the materials repel water effectively. This is particularly crucial for leather boots, which can suffer if they absorb too much water.
-
Store Boots Correctly: Correct storage is vital for shape retention. Store boots in a cool, dry place away from sunlight. Consider using boot trees to maintain structure and avoid deformation.
-
Replace Insoles and Laces as Needed: Worn insoles can affect comfort and support. Replacing them regularly ensures optimal performance. Additionally, sturdy laces promote a secure fit, so replace frayed laces promptly.
-
Inspect for Damage Frequently: Routine inspections can catch potential issues early. Look for cracks, seams, or worn areas. Addressing minor repairs quickly can prevent larger problems down the line.
-
Avoid Excessive Exposure to Heat: Minimizing exposure to direct heat is essential for preserving materials. High temperatures can weaken adhesives and rubber components, leading to premature wear.
By following these maintenance tips, men can significantly extend the lifespan of their backpacking boots and enhance their hiking experience.
